Transaction fcab3a61fe572206e6a803a8070294e6a0105e271d07495bd8188c3ad6e0f938
1 Input
1 Output
-
fcab3a61fe572206e6a803a8070294e6a0105e271d07495bd8188c3ad6e0f938:0
- value
- 2372961
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38ae86d8c43c66a85fc07633adedf8cefde0a5ee OP_EQUAL
- address
- 36riqckANPEkSJyo51f2Ncvewk5puoP14E